Clearwing Moth

Melittia chalciformis

Taxonomy :
Kingdom: Animalia
Phylum: Arthropoda
Class: Insecta
Order: Lepidoptera
Superfamily: Sesioidea
Family: Sesiidae
Genus: Melittia
Species: Melittia chalciformis

Habitat:

Dense bushes, forests

Notes:

Found resting on a plant, with wings folded. A rare thing to see this moth resting.
